> For some reason (or another?) my middle unit keeps re-creating the
gate0
> every few seconds. Sometimes it loses it completely and sometimes it
keeps
> it for 10 seconds or so. The furthest node from the gw keeps it's
tunnel
> permanently configured (which is nice).
to get to the bottom of your problem I need debug level 3 output. If
you start
the daemon with "-d 3" or connect to the running daemon with "batmand
-c -d 3"
and send me that output I will be able to figure it out.
> Basically, node-to-node traffic is ok, very stable and very nice but
> node-through-gw is flaky.
On all nodes or just from that one ?
